#bce855 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bce855 is composed of 73.7% red, 91%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.4%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 78 degrees, a saturation of 76.2% and a lightness of 62.2%. #bce855 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ffaa with #79d100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#bce855 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bce855 has RGB values of R:188, G:232,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 12380245.

Shades and Tints of #bce855
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bce855
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a598 is the less saturated color, while #c5fe3f is the most saturated one.
